| Re: Sunglasses! I have quite a few pairs of high end glasses and use them extensively in the summer time. The thought of not using them; squinting, fighting glare, UV continually bombarding the eye just isn't an option. I want to see the road and see all of it all the time.
I have a couple of pairs of Serengetis, drivers and an old pair of S7000s I've had repaired 3 times, Maui Jim Titaniums, and a pair of Vuarnets for extra bright days.
The S7000s have the extra glare protection on the top and the bottom and a normal strip through the middle and are so heavy I get a sore neck but they're comfortable like an old sweater and are clear as a bell.
I've always worried about cheap glasses causing the eye to open more allowing more UV in to damage the interior lens, so good glass and UV and polarization are always on my shopping list.
